There isn’t much electricity you can use outside but when you do use electricity outside, you want to make sure everything you do use is safe and secure. There are a variety of ways to do this, one of which involves using an exterior outlet box. This nifty tool protects your outdoor plugs from the elements, and still allows for cords to be plugged in while you are using it.
An outdoor power outlet box is in many ways a small house for your outdoor plugs. It protects them from rain, sleet, snow and other weather that could harm them. It'll help to keep your outdoor plugs dry and in working order.
